Founded by Jimmy and Mai Swan, His Kidz United aims to bring uplifting Christian music to kids between the ages of 5 and 14. The Swans felt that because the music was for kids, the songs should be sung by kids to have the most impact. Because of that conviction, students from the Dallas Neighborhood Art & Music School (NAMS) were asked to cover songs from popular CCM artists, but with a kid twist, for His Kidz United Vol. 1.

In a blast from the past, the students from NAMS sing Audio Adrenaline's "Big House." It sounds almost exactly like the Audio A version, only with kid voices. "Big House" by His Kidz United is just as fun as the original, and it's a great way to connect with your kids if you were an Audio A fan back in the day.

Another great cover is Matt Redman's "10,000 Reasons." A popular worship song done in many churches today, the His Kidz United version brings Sunday morning worship to your kids any time during the week. His Kidz United Vol. 1 also includes a cover of TobyMac's 2012 hit "Speak Life."

Closing Thoughts:
Hid Kidz United Vol. 1 has talented young singers that produce a much better quality product than other "by kids for kids" CDs on the market. Unlike others out there, the songs on His Kidz didn't have to be modified to be "kid-friendly," and that's a big selling point. You're never too young to worship God, and His Kidz United Vol. 1 proves that point well. I like the motivation behind His Kids United, and I look forward to sharing their music with my own kids!
